DEVELOPMENT OF SPARKOL VIDEOSCRIBE-BASED LEARNING MEDIA USING THE ADDIE MODEL FOR VOCATIONAL TOURISM EDUCATION: A FEASIBILITY AND EFFECTIVENESS STUDY

Abstract

The integration of digital media in vocational education remains underexplored, particularly in the context of tourism subjects at the secondary vocational level. Conventional instructional methods—such as dictation, static PowerPoint presentations, and paper-based assignments—have been widely reported to reduce student engagement and learning motivation. This study addresses this gap by developing and evaluating Sparkol VideoScribe-based animated whiteboard learning media for the Productive Tourism subject at Grade X of SMK Negeri 1 Boyolangu, Tulungagung, Indonesia. The ADDIE instructional design model (Analysis, Design, Development, Implementation, and Evaluation) was employed as the systematic development framework. Feasibility was assessed through expert validation and user trials. A Media Expert validated the product and awarded a score of 83% (Very Feasible), while a Content Expert assigned 87.5% (Very Feasible). Small-group trials (n = 5) yielded 77.6% (Very Feasible), and large-group trials (n = 20) produced 90% (Very Feasible), resulting in an overall mean feasibility score of 84.5%. These findings demonstrate that Sparkol VideoScribe-based media represents a technically sound and pedagogically appropriate learning tool for vocational tourism education. The novelty of this research lies in its systematic application of the ADDIE framework to develop whiteboard animation media specifically contextualized for hospitality and tourism competencies in Indonesian vocational secondary schools. Future research should examine the media's direct impact on student learning outcomes and explore adaptive integration with mobile and cloud-based learning environments
